Avocado Chocolate Mousse with Pomegranate

This rich, creamy chocolate mousse gets a nutritious twist with avocado and is sweetened with stevia to keep it blood sugar-friendly. Topped with vibrant pomegranate seeds, it’s an indulgent yet healthy dessert that’s as beautiful as it is delicious.

Ingredients

  • 2 ripe avocados, peeled and pitted

  • ¼ cup unsweetened cocoa powder

  • ½ cup almond milk (or any milk alternative)

  • 2 tbsp stevia (or adjust to taste)

  • 1 tsp vanilla extract

  • Pinch of sea salt

  • ¼ cup pomegranate seeds, for topping

Directions

  • In a blender or food processor, combine avocados, cocoa powder, almond milk, stevia, vanilla extract, and sea salt. Blend until smooth and creamy.
  • Taste and adjust sweetness with additional stevia if needed.
  • Spoon the mousse into serving dishes and refrigerate for 1-2 hours to chill.
  • Just before serving, sprinkle each dish with fresh pomegranate seeds for a pop of color and flavor.
  • Serve chilled and enjoy!

Notes

  • Why It Works: Avocado provides a creamy texture and healthy monounsaturated fats that help regulate blood sugar. Stevia sweetens without adding carbs, and the pomegranate seeds not only add a tangy sweetness but are also rich in antioxidants and fiber. This dessert is a delicious balance of indulgence and nutrition, perfect for those managing blood sugar levels.
